Sandstone

ISL mining is defined as the process of uranium extraction from the host sandstone in situ by injecting the chemical leach solutions directly into the ore zone. The pregnant solutions containing leached uranium are transported to the surface through production wells. Uranium is recovered from the solutions to produce yellowcake. Get price

Introduction to uranium in situ recovery technology

Jan 01, 20167.1. General description 7.1.1. The ISR technique. In situ is a Latin word that translates literally to "on site" or "in position." Unlike conventional mining methods, where the uranium mineral and host rock are excavated together and the uranium is recovered on the surface, in situ recovery (ISR) technique removes the uranium while leaving the host rock in place. Recovery of Copper by Solution Mining Techniques

There are essentially two types of solution mining: 1) in-situ and 2) in-place. In-place solution mining requires permeability enhancement techniques such as blasting or previous mining activities (i.e. block-caving) to fragment or increase the permeability of the rock prior to applying a leaching solution to liberate ore from the surrounding Get price

In Situ Leach Mining (ISL) of Uranium

The leach liquors pass through the ore to oxidise and dissolve the uranium minerals in situ. Depending on the type of leaching environment used the uranium will be complexed as either a uranyl sulphate, predominantly UO 2 (SO 4 ) 3 4-, in acid leach conditions or a uranyl carbonate, predominantly UO 2 (CO 3 ) 3 4- in a carbonate leach system.
